**Ticket #—Turnstile upgrade, Marrowgate lobby.** Turnstiles in the Marrowgate lobby are being replaced this week. Old badges will not scan until reprovisioning completes Friday. New starters: use the side gate next to the reception desk instead. Gate is staffed 08:00–18:00 only. Outside those hours, enter via the courtyard door using the temporary code below.

door code, kahop-hahip: bdg-MIPXG-71662

Vendor note for review: the Larkspur Bakery contract sets a hard order cutoff at 14:00 local the day before delivery. The patch enforces this in the ordering service — reject, don't queue, anything after cutoff. Edge case: orders placed exactly at 14:00:00 are accepted per the contract wording. Please confirm the timezone handling matches the bakery's local clock, not ours. Questions on the contract terms go here.

escalation mailbox, bafog-fafog: ulador@paliqlabs.internal

## Deploying the Gatewick Proctor Queue

Deploys are pretty painless: push to main, wait for the pipeline, then watch the queue drain dashboard for five minutes. If candidates pile up mid-exam, roll back first and ask questions later — the queue replays safely. Everything the workers care about lives in one config block, shown here for reference.

settings of bafof-yagef:
JOROX_PIN=8740
JOROX_TENANT=pelox
JOROX_METRICS_HOST=metrics.jorox.qorvelworks.internal
JOROX_SEAL=seal_c78f63c1
JOROX_STANDBY_TEAM=norax